1. 输入需要解码的url编码字符串 url_encoded_str="你的url编码字符串" 1. 2. 对字符串进行url解码 importurllib.parse decoded_str=urllib.parse.unquote(url_encoded_str) 1. 2. 3. 这里使用了urllib.parse.unquote()函数来解码url编码的字符串。 3. 将解码后的字符串进行Unicode转码 unicode_str=decoded_...
我们首先需要导入这个模块。 # 导入urllib.parse模块importurllib.parse 1. 2. 步骤2: 使用unquote方法解码URL 使用urllib.parse模块中的unquote()函数,可以将经过URL编码的字符串解码为正常的字符。我们可以传入一个URL编码的字符串作为参数。 # 定义一个URL编码的字符串url_encoded_str="Hello%20world%20%E4%BD...
python url Python提供了一些内置函数和标准库来编码和解码URL,例如urllib.parse.unquote()函数,可以将URL中的转义字符解码为其原始字符表示。以下是一个演示如何对URL中的转码后的中文再转码回去的例子: import urllib.parse # URL中转码后的中文 url = 'https://www.example.com/%E4%B8%AD%E6%96%87' # ...
#1——将中文“中国”转换成URL编码a=quote('中国')print("中国的url编码为:"+a)#中国的url编码为:%E4%B8%AD%E5%9B%BD#2——将URL编码转换成字符str="%E4%B8%AD%E5%9B%BD"b=unquote(str)print("%E4%B8%AD%E5%9B%BD的url解码为:"+b)#%E4%B8%AD%E5%9B%BD的url解码为:中国#python中可...
今天要处理百度贴吧的东西。想要做一个关键词的list,每次需要时,直接添加 到list里面就可以了。但是添加到list里面是中文的情况(比如'丽江'),url的地址编码却是'%E4%B8%BD%E6%B1%9F',因此需 要做一个转换。这里我们就用到了模块urllib。 >>> import urllib ...
Python URL地址中汉字的编码转换 Python3 编码 解码 示例 """ utf8 编码"""fromurllib.requestimportquote, unquoteurl1 ="https://www.baidu.com/s?wd=百度"# utf8编码,指定安全字符ret1 = quote(url1, safe=";/?:@&=+$,", encoding="utf-8")print(ret1)...
今天修改一个天气预报的东西,但输入城市不能得到天气预报,感觉是编码不对,因为你输入一个城市(比如‘杭州’),url的地址编码却是'%E4%B8%BD%E6%B1%9F',因此需 要做一个转换。这里我们就用到了模块urllib。 复制 >>>import urllib>>>data='杭州'>>>print data ...
# :的url编码为%3A,可输出 http://www.baidu.com urllib.parse.unquote('http%3A//www.baidu.com') 其它应用 URL中%u开头的字符 在网页的表单参数中,还遇到过%u开头的字符,得知是中文对应的Unicode编码值 以下代码可以实现字符与unicode编码值的转换 ...
python爬虫小知识,中文在url中的编码解码 有时候我们做爬虫经常会遇到这种编码格式,大概的样式为 %xx%xx%xx,对于这部分编码,python提供了一个quote的方法来编码,对应的解码为unquote方法。导入 quote方法是urllib库的一个方法,它的导入方式为 from urllib.parse import quote,unquote不需要安装,urllib库是python...